A new Australia Post delivery facility at Kadina that will triple to amount of parcels that can be mailed across the region has opened.
The modern, purpose-built facility replaces a former delivery site and can process up to 2400 parcels per day – more than triple the capacity of the previous site.
It is the first of four new facilities to open across regional South Australia, all of which have been designed to increase the number of parcels it can mail and improve delivery speed as online shopping rises.
Australia Post general manager of network operations Khaled Elkhatib said the site would ensure regional communities continued to get reliable and efficient delivery services as demand grew.

“Online spend in South Australia rose 14 per cent to $5.6 billion last year, according to our latest Annual eCommerce Report,” he said.
“As more people shop online, particularly in regional areas, we’re continuing to invest in our regional network to keep pace with demand and changing customer needs, to deliver a better, more reliable service for our customers into the future.

“Designed to improve safety for our team members, increase capacity and streamline operations, including transport flows, the new facility will help our team get parcels on the road faster and deliver them to our customers as efficiently as possible.
“It will also strengthen our ability to support local businesses, helping them reach more customers and grow through eCommerce,” said Mr Elkhatib.
Owner of sheep shearing clothing business Just Shear Carlie Smith said the new facility would allow the business to grow.

“As a growing rural business, we rely on Australia Post to connect us with customers across the country,” she said.
“It’s fantastic to see the opening of this new facility, making it easier for us to send more products to customers and continue growing while creating more local jobs.”
The site is powered completely by rooftop solar and stored battery energy.
It comes as Australia Post builds a $500m Adelaide Parcel Super Hub, which is expected to open in 2028.
